Strip Out Small Demolitions have actually rapidly turned into one of the most requested services amongst renovators, proprietors, and tradespeople across Sydney, NSW, as more people choose to refresh existing areas rather than go back to square one. When a bathroom is obsoleted, a kitchen no longer fits the family, or an office fit-out needs to be gutted before new tenants move in, Strip Out Small Demolitions supply the fastest and cleanest path forward. This kind of work sits between light handyman jobs and major demolition, focusing on the safe removal of non-load-bearing components such as cabinets, tiling, plasterboard, carpet, and old fixtures. Because Strip Out Small Demolitions do not generally include structural modifications, they can usually be finished without engineering approvals, making them a cost-effective option for property owners who desire results without months of bureaucracy. Throughout Sydney's diverse housing stock, from federation cottages to compact apartment or condo blocks, the appeal of Strip Out Small Demolitions depends on how rapidly a tired space can be cleared and prepared for the next stage of a renovation.
An effective small‑scale strip‑out demolition depends upon cautious preparation and sequencing, specifically when the structure is still occupied or the website is constrained-- a typical circumstance in Sydney's inner‑ring suburbs. Skilled groups will figure out which elements can be raised out manually, which need to be taken apart methodically to secure adjacent structures, and the most effective method to transfer materials off the facilities without inconveniencing neighbours or obstructing walkways. This is especially important for apartments and balcony homes where lift gain access to is limited or council parking rules limit the length of time a truck may stay on site. Choosing a professional who comprehends the on‑the‑ground difficulties of small‑scale strip‑out operate in a busy city can be the choosing factor between a seamless two‑day operation and a protracted, annoying ordeal. Numerous clients find that combining the strip‑out with a coordinated waste‑removal service saves a lot of time, as the same crew can carry away debris instantly instead of leaving piles of rubbish to stick around on the residential or commercial property for days.
Arranging waste is a basic aspect of any conscientious small‑scale demolition service, and standards have risen sharply in the last few years. Instead of consigning every drawn out product to landfill, skilled crews now segregate wood, metal hardware, glass, and plasterboard so that recyclables are managed properly. This is particularly crucial in older Sydney houses, where strip‑outs frequently reveal solid wood doors, cast‑iron components, or period tiles that can be rescued instead of tossed. Consumers carrying out small demolitions are progressively inquiring about waste‑diversion techniques, mirroring a larger community demand for sustainable renovation. A specialist who can plainly detail how a strip‑out's materials are separated, recycled, or recycled offers real included value beyond merely clearing a location, and this openness has become a distinguishing factor amongst waste‑removal companies vying for restoration projects throughout the city.
Budgeting for small strip‑out demolition is generally less complex than lots of property owners prepare for, as long as they partner with a specialist who provides transparent, fixed rates instead of unclear quotes. Given that these jobs are usually priced according to the amount of material to be cleared and the labor required, owners can weigh the expense against do it yourself options like renting a skip bin. In most circumstances, employing a specialist for small‑scale strip‑outs ends up being more cost‑effective once the worth of time, effort and disposal charges are considered-- particularly for households and experts who lack an extra weekend to manage the waste themselves. Professionals and renovators supervising several sites throughout Sydney also value the dependability of standardized prices, allowing them to integrate strip‑out expenses into total spending plans without unexpected overruns. This level of predictability has turned small‑scale strip‑out demolition into a routine line item in remodelling strategies rather than an afterthought.
